From d4bbe0ab0ae9296054b56fe2ec66d9d9eba53c7d Mon Sep 17 00:00:00 2001 From: brian Date: Tue, 2 Jun 2009 10:45:02 +0000 Subject: [PATCH] b=19671 i=jack i=wangyb Give lbuild's old-school-build RPM storage code the ability to understand the format of RPMs built from OFED pre-releases. --- build/lbuild.old_school |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/build/lbuild.old_school b/build/lbuild.old_school index d36861b..869be39 100644 --- a/build/lbuild.old_school +++ b/build/lbuild.old_school @@ -305,8 +305,10 @@ store_for_reuse() { if [ -n "$OFED_VERSION" -a "$OFED_VERSION" != "inkernel" ]; then # store kernel-ib RPMs local rpmname + local ofed_version=$(echo $OFED_VERSION | + sed -re 's/-(20[0-9]{6,6}-[0-9]{4,4}|rc[0-9]*)$//') for rpmname in "kernel-ib" "kernel-ib-devel"; do - rpmname="${rpmname}-${OFED_VERSION}" + rpmname="${rpmname}-${ofed_version}" if $PATCHLESS; then rpmname="${rpmname}-${LINUXRELEASE//-/_}" else -- 1.8.3.1